Indonesian Rupiah

The Indonesian Rupiah (IDR) is the official currency of Indonesia, the world's fourth most populous country and Southeast Asia's largest economy. Managed by Bank Indonesia, the rupiah is quoted at large nominal values (typically 15,000–16,000 per USD). Indonesia is a major exporter of coal, palm oil, nickel, and natural gas. The rupiah's large nominal denomination reflects historical inflation — no redenomination has occurred since the 1950s, so prices of everyday goods routinely run into the millions of rupiah.

Nigerian Naira

The Nigerian Naira (NGN) is the official currency of Nigeria, Africa's most populous country and largest economy by nominal GDP. Managed by the Central Bank of Nigeria, the naira has experienced significant depreciation in recent years following the unification of multiple exchange rate windows in 2023. Nigeria is a major oil producer and OPEC member, making the naira heavily exposed to global oil price volatility. The naira symbol (₦) was designed by Alhaji Abubakar Usman and adopted when the naira replaced the pound in 1973.
